We inspect leaking or worn roof valleys across Stirling. We assess the lining, supporting boards, cut slate or tile edges, underlay and the route water takes from the adjoining slopes. The cause and repair options are set out in plain English with a free written quotation.

A valley receives water from two slopes, so the channel, edges and supporting layers must work together.

Assessment and scope

How roof valley repairs in Stirling are specified

The lining material, length, pitch and surrounding covering determine whether a local repair or more extensive renewal is proportionate.

Valley length, material, pitch, surrounding covering and the condition of supporting layers determine the proposed work.

  • Keep the water path clear.
  • Inspect both sides of the valley.
  • Check the outlet or gutter receiving the flow.

Roof valley repairs for Stirling rainfall

Valleys carry more water than the surrounding roof surface. Small defects, debris or poorly supported edges can therefore have a disproportionate effect during sustained rain.
